Exploring the Best Coastal Mezes from India’s Beaches

India, with its vast coastline stretching over 7,500 kilometers, is home to a vibrant culinary culture that offers an array of delightful coastal mezes. These small dishes embody the freshness of seafood and the richness of local flavors. Let's explore some of the best coastal mezes you can savor at India's stunning beaches.

1. Prawn Koliwada
The coastal state of Maharashtra is known for its Prawn Koliwada. This dish features prawns marinated in a spicy blend of ginger-garlic paste, chili powder, and chickpea flour, deep-fried to perfection. Served with a tangy tamarind chutney, this crispy delight is a must-try along the beaches of Mumbai and surrounding areas.

2. Fish Amritsari
Originating from Northern India but popular along coastal regions, Fish Amritsari is a spiced batter-fried fish that is both crispy and savory. Typically made with local fish like bombil or surmai, it’s seasoned with various spices and served hot with onion rings and green chutney, making it a perfect beach snack.

3. Kerala-style Fish Fry
The beaches of Kerala are famous for their fish fry, a dish that highlights the state’s abundant marine catch. Fresh fish is marinated in a blend of spices including turmeric, red chili powder, and coriander, before being pan-fried to achieve a crispy exterior. Enjoy it with a side of lemon wedges and a refreshing salad.

4. Crab Curry
No visit to the coastal regions of India is complete without indulging in a rich crab curry, especially in Goa and Kerala. This dish combines succulent crab pieces with a fragrant coconut milk base and a medley of spices. The curry is best paired with steamed rice or appams, making it a hearty coastal meal.

5. Puliogare
This tangy and spicy rice dish is particularly popular in Southern India, especially in Tamil Nadu. Made with tamarind, peanuts, and a mix of spices, Puliogare is often enjoyed as a light meal or snack at the beach. Its robust flavors make it a delightful option for those who prefer vegetarian choices.

6. Mangalorean Fish Curry
Known for its vibrant flavors, Mangalorean fish curry is a staple in coastal Karnataka. This dish is characterized by its unique combination of freshly ground spices, typically including roasted coriander and red chilies. Served with steamed rice, it provides a taste of the region’s culinary heritage.

7. Tahiri
A lesser-known gem from the coastal areas of Andhra Pradesh, Tahiri is a flavorful rice dish cooked with fish and spices. Its aromatic qualities and balance of flavors make it a delightful coastal breakfast option, often enjoyed with a side of pickles and yogurt.

8. Bombil Fry
This famous Bombay duck, popularly known as Bombil, is a delicacy found along the coasts of Mumbai and neighboring regions. The fish is lightly battered and fried until crisp. It’s typically enjoyed with rice or chapati and a squeeze of lime juice, providing a flavorful burst with each bite.

9. Appam with Seafood Stew
In Kerala, appams are soft and fluffy rice pancakes that pair beautifully with a rich seafood stew. The stew, made with coconut milk and a variety of seafood, projects a harmony of flavors that defines coastal dining in this region.

10. Fish Tikka
This North Indian favorite has found its way to several coastal locations, where fresh fish is marinated in yogurt and spices before being grilled to perfection. Fish tikka is an excellent option for seafood lovers looking to enjoy a smokey flavor along with a slightly tangy dipping sauce.

Whether you find yourself lounging on a sunlit beach or enjoying the hustle and bustle of a coastal town, these coastal mezes are the perfect accompaniment to your seaside experience. Savoring these delightful dishes not only tantalizes your taste buds but also offers a delightful glimpse into the rich culinary traditions of India's vibrant coastline.
